The Sodium Ammonium Vanadate Market was valued at USD 92 million in 2025 and is expected to reach USD 135.62 million by 2034, growing at a Compound Annual Growth Rate (CAGR) of 4.4% during the forecast period (2025–2034). This growth is driven by increasing demand in the petrochemical industry, expanding industrial applications, and rising global investments in chemical R&D.

Sodium Ammonium Vanadate (Na3V2(O4)2O6) is a versatile inorganic compound used primarily in the production of high-performance batteries, advanced ceramics, and specialty chemicals. Its unique crystalline structure provides excellent ionic conductivity and chemical stability, making it indispensable in modern industrial applications.

North America
North America represents a mature and significant market for Sodium Ammonium Vanadate, characterized by a well-established industrial base, particularly in the United States and Canada. The region’s demand is primarily driven by its advanced petrochemical sector and stringent application standards. A strong focus on research and development activities supports the adoption of the compound in specialized industrial processes. While facing competition from alternative materials and navigating regulatory frameworks, the market maintains steady consumption due to its technological sophistication and high-value industrial applications. Mexico also contributes to regional demand, supported by its growing manufacturing sector.
Europe
Europe is a key consumer market, with countries like Germany, the United Kingdom, and France showing significant demand. The region’s well-developed chemical industry and high standards for industrial materials underpin its consumption of Sodium Ammonium Vanadate. European markets are driven by applications in advanced manufacturing and chemical synthesis. The region must balance this demand with strict environmental and safety regulations, which can influence market dynamics. Despite these challenges, a strong industrial base and commitment to innovation ensure a consistent and quality-focused market presence.
South America
The South American market for Sodium Ammonium Vanadate exhibits moderate but growing demand, led by countries such as Brazil and Argentina. Growth is supported by developing industrial sectors and increasing investments in chemical and petrochemical industries. The market potential is significant, though it is currently smaller compared to other regions. Challenges include economic volatility and evolving regulatory landscapes. However, the ongoing industrialization and exploration of new applications present opportunities for future market expansion in the region.
Middle East & Africa
The Middle East and Africa region is an emerging market with growth potential, particularly in countries like Saudi Arabia and South Africa. Demand is driven by increasing industrial activities and investments in the petrochemical sector, especially in the Middle East. Africa shows nascent growth, with potential linked to future industrial development. The market faces challenges related to infrastructure development and regulatory frameworks. Nevertheless, the region’s strategic focus on expanding its industrial base positions it as an area of growing interest for Sodium Ammonium Vanadate applications.
